Loreto students and staff raised over £300 for breast cancer research through the colour pink, music and song. The college choir, open to all students and staff who rehearse every friday under the direction of Head of Music Mr Lloyd-Mostyn sang a medley of songs to passing crowds at Loreto. Lining the stairway and foyer in Ellis and Kennedy building, the students, all dressed in pink sang their hearts out and brought smiles and foot tapping to all. The jazz band also performed a set of upbeat repertoire, with the annual performance of ‘The Pink Panther’.

Mr Price, Head of Performing Arts said “our students take such pride in the work that they do for charity. Having the choir and jazz band share their musical talents to support such a worthy cause was wonderful to witness’
